Can You Take Weight Loss Injections With Hypothyroidism?

13
 min read by:
Fella

Many individuals with hypothyroidism struggle with weight management despite optimized thyroid hormone replacement therapy. As newer weight loss injections like semaglutide (Wegovy) and tirzepatide (Zepbound) gain prominence, patients and clinicians frequently ask: can you take weight loss injections with hypothyroidism? Current evidence indicates that GLP-1 receptor agonists can be safely used in patients with well-controlled hypothyroidism, with no absolute contraindication for those with standard thyroid conditions. However, important considerations regarding thyroid medication interactions, dose adjustments during weight loss, and specific safety monitoring warrant careful medical evaluation before initiating treatment.

Quick Answer: Weight loss injections can be safely used in patients with well-controlled hypothyroidism, with no absolute contraindication for standard thyroid conditions.

  • GLP-1 receptor agonists like semaglutide and tirzepatide work independently of thyroid function through appetite suppression and delayed gastric emptying.
  • These medications are contraindicated only in patients with personal or family history of medullary thyroid carcinoma or Multiple Endocrine Neoplasia syndrome type 2.
  • Thyroid function monitoring is recommended when starting weight loss injections, as significant weight loss may require levothyroxine dose adjustments.
  • Delayed gastric emptying from GLP-1 medications could theoretically affect levothyroxine absorption, warranting continued optimal timing of thyroid medication.
  • Hypothyroidism should be adequately controlled before initiating weight loss therapy to optimize outcomes and simplify medication management.

Understanding Hypothyroidism and Weight Management Challenges

Hypothyroidism occurs when the thyroid gland produces insufficient thyroid hormones, affecting approximately 4-8% of the US population (with overt hypothyroidism affecting 0.3-0.5%). This condition significantly impacts metabolism, making weight management particularly challenging for affected individuals.

The thyroid hormones thyroxine (T4) and triiodothyronine (T3) regulate basal metabolic rate, thermogenesis, and energy expenditure. When these hormones are deficient, patients typically experience a reduction in metabolic rate that varies with disease severity, contributing to gradual weight gain even with unchanged dietary habits. Additional symptoms including fatigue, cold intolerance, and reduced physical activity further compound weight management difficulties.

Patients with hypothyroidism often report frustration with traditional weight loss approaches. Even with optimized thyroid hormone replacement therapy using levothyroxine, many individuals continue to struggle with weight management despite achieving euthyroid status (normal thyroid function tests).

The weight challenges associated with hypothyroidism are multifactorial. Beyond metabolic slowing, patients may experience fluid retention, decreased fat breakdown, and alterations in appetite-regulating hormones. The condition also affects gut motility and can lead to constipation, contributing to abdominal discomfort and perceived weight gain. Understanding these complex mechanisms is essential when considering weight loss interventions, as hypothyroid patients require tailored approaches that address both their metabolic challenges and underlying endocrine dysfunction. This complexity has led many patients and clinicians to explore adjunctive weight loss therapies, including newer injectable medications.

How Weight Loss Injections Work in the Body

Weight loss injections primarily refer to glucagon-like peptide-1 (GLP-1) receptor agonists, including semaglutide (Wegovy), tirzepatide (Zepbound), and liraglutide (Saxenda). These medications represent a significant advancement in obesity pharmacotherapy, with clinical trials demonstrating substantial weight loss benefits.

Mechanism of Action:

GLP-1 receptor agonists work through multiple physiological pathways:

  • Central appetite suppression: These medications cross the blood-brain barrier and activate GLP-1 receptors in the hypothalamus and brainstem, reducing hunger signals and increasing satiety

  • Gastric emptying delay: By slowing stomach emptying, patients experience prolonged fullness after meals

  • Insulin secretion enhancement: Glucose-dependent insulin release improves glycemic control

  • Glucagon suppression: Reduced glucagon secretion decreases hepatic glucose production

Tirzepatide offers dual agonism at both GLP-1 and glucose-dependent insulinotropic polypeptide (GIP) receptors, potentially providing enhanced weight loss efficacy compared to single-agonist medications. In the SURMOUNT-1 trial, tirzepatide demonstrated 15-22% weight loss over 72 weeks. Similarly, semaglutide 2.4 mg showed approximately 15% weight loss over 68 weeks in the STEP 1 trial.

These medications are administered via subcutaneous injection, typically weekly. The FDA has approved Wegovy (semaglutide 2.4 mg), Zepbound (tirzepatide), and Saxenda (liraglutide 3 mg) for chronic weight management in adults with obesity (BMI ≥30 kg/m²) or overweight (BMI ≥27 kg/m²) with at least one weight-related comorbidity. Ozempic (semaglutide) and Mounjaro (tirzepatide) are FDA-approved for type 2 diabetes management, not weight loss, though they may be used off-label for this purpose.

Importantly, GLP-1 receptor agonists do not directly affect thyroid hormone production or metabolism. Their weight loss effects occur independently of thyroid function. However, their effect on gastric emptying may potentially affect the absorption of oral medications, including those with a narrow therapeutic index.

Safety of Weight Loss Injections with Hypothyroidism

Current evidence suggests that GLP-1 receptor agonists can be safely used in patients with well-controlled hypothyroidism, though several important considerations warrant attention. There is no absolute contraindication to using these medications in hypothyroid patients, and clinical trials have included participants with thyroid disorders.

Key Safety Considerations:

The FDA mandates a boxed warning regarding thyroid C-cell tumors. Animal studies demonstrated thyroid C-cell hyperplasia and medullary thyroid carcinoma (MTC) in rodents exposed to these medications. However, the clinical relevance to humans remains unknown, as rodents have substantially higher C-cell density than humans. These medications are contraindicated in patients with:

  • Personal history of medullary thyroid carcinoma

  • Family history of medullary thyroid carcinoma

  • Multiple Endocrine Neoplasia syndrome type 2 (MEN 2)

For patients with standard hypothyroidism (typically autoimmune thyroiditis or post-ablation), these contraindications do not apply.

Additional safety considerations include:

  • Acute pancreatitis risk: Patients should be monitored for severe abdominal pain

  • Gallbladder disease: Including cholelithiasis and cholecystitis

  • Dehydration and acute kidney injury: Particularly with gastrointestinal side effects

  • Hypoglycemia: When used with insulin or sulfonylureas in patients with diabetes

  • Diabetic retinopathy complications: Particularly with semaglutide in patients with pre-existing retinopathy

Patients with hypothyroidism should undergo thyroid function monitoring when starting weight loss injections. While these medications don't directly alter thyroid hormone levels, significant weight loss can affect thyroid hormone requirements. Some patients may need levothyroxine dose adjustments as they lose weight, as thyroid hormone dosing is partially weight-based.

Common adverse effects—nausea, vomiting, diarrhea, and constipation—occur similarly in hypothyroid and euthyroid patients. These gastrointestinal symptoms typically diminish over 4-8 weeks as tolerance develops. Patients should be counseled about gradual dose titration to minimize these effects.

Thyroid Medication Interactions with Weight Loss Treatments

Understanding potential interactions between levothyroxine and weight loss injections is crucial for optimal therapeutic outcomes. While no direct pharmacokinetic interaction has been established between GLP-1 receptor agonists and thyroid hormone replacement, the delayed gastric emptying effect of these medications could theoretically affect absorption of oral medications, including those with a narrow therapeutic index like levothyroxine.

Absorption Considerations:

Levothyroxine absorption occurs primarily in the small intestine, with peak absorption within 2-4 hours of administration. Because GLP-1 receptor agonists delay gastric emptying, monitoring thyroid function is advisable when initiating or adjusting doses of these medications.

Patients should continue taking levothyroxine on an empty stomach, 30-60 minutes before breakfast, as recommended regardless of weight loss injection use. This timing optimization helps ensure consistent absorption and minimizes variability. Levothyroxine should also be separated from calcium and iron supplements by at least 4 hours.

Dose Adjustment Requirements:

As patients achieve significant weight loss, thyroid hormone requirements may change. Levothyroxine dosing is influenced by body weight, with typical maintenance doses ranging from 1.6-1.8 mcg/kg/day based on ideal or lean body weight (using actual body weight in obesity may lead to overreplacement). Older adults and those with coronary disease typically require lower doses. A patient losing 15-20% body weight may require dose reduction to avoid iatrogenic hyperthyroidism.

Clinicians should monitor thyroid function tests (TSH, free T4) at:

  • Baseline before starting weight loss injections

  • 6-8 weeks after achieving maintenance dose

  • Every 3-6 months during active weight loss

  • After significant weight stabilization

Symptoms of overreplacement (palpitations, anxiety, tremor, heat intolerance) should prompt earlier testing. Conversely, recurrent hypothyroid symptoms during weight loss may indicate inadequate replacement, though this is less common.

Other Medication Considerations:

Patients taking medications for comorbid conditions (diabetes, hypertension) may require adjustments as weight loss progresses. This is particularly relevant for patients with subclinical hypothyroidism who may have metabolic syndrome components. Close collaboration between endocrinology and primary care ensures comprehensive medication management during weight loss therapy.

Medical Considerations Before Starting Weight Loss Injections

Patients with hypothyroidism considering weight loss injections require comprehensive medical evaluation to ensure safety and optimize outcomes. This assessment should address thyroid-specific factors and general candidacy for GLP-1 therapy.

Thyroid Status Optimization:

Before initiating weight loss injections, hypothyroidism should be adequately controlled. Target TSH levels should typically fall within the laboratory reference range, with individualization based on age, comorbidities, and clinical context. Starting weight loss therapy with uncontrolled hypothyroidism may:

  • Confound assessment of treatment efficacy

  • Complicate symptom attribution (fatigue, constipation overlap)

  • Necessitate multiple medication adjustments simultaneously

Practically speaking, patients may benefit from demonstrating stable thyroid function on consistent levothyroxine dosing before adding weight loss medications, though this is not a strict requirement.

Comprehensive Medical Screening:

Clinicians should evaluate for:

  • Thyroid nodules or goiter: Baseline neck examination and review of recent thyroid ultrasound if clinically indicated

  • Personal or family history of thyroid cancer: Particularly medullary thyroid carcinoma

  • Comorbid conditions: Type 2 diabetes, cardiovascular disease, pancreatitis history

  • Gastrointestinal disorders: Severe gastroparesis (potential contraindication)

  • Renal function: Use caution in patients at risk for volume depletion/renal impairment

  • Psychiatric conditions: Depression, eating disorders

  • Pregnancy status: These medications are not recommended during pregnancy and should be discontinued when pregnancy is recognized

Laboratory Assessment:

Baseline testing should include:

  • TSH and free T4

  • Comprehensive metabolic panel (renal and hepatic function)

  • Lipid panel

  • Hemoglobin A1c (if diabetic or prediabetic)

Routine calcitonin screening or thyroid ultrasound is not recommended solely for GLP-1 therapy initiation. Thyroid nodules should be evaluated according to standard American Thyroid Association guidelines.

Patient Education:

Patients should understand that weight loss injections are adjunctive therapy requiring lifestyle modification. Realistic expectations include 10-15% weight loss over 6-12 months, with individual variation. Discussion should cover injection technique, adverse effect management, cost considerations (often $900-1,300 monthly without insurance coverage), and long-term treatment duration, as weight regain commonly occurs after discontinuation.

Alternative Weight Management Strategies for Thyroid Patients

While weight loss injections offer significant benefits, multiple evidence-based alternatives exist for hypothyroid patients seeking weight management. A comprehensive approach often yields optimal results.

Thyroid Hormone Optimization:

Ensuring adequate thyroid replacement remains foundational. Some patients benefit from combination T4/T3 therapy, though evidence supporting superiority over levothyroxine monotherapy is limited. The American Thyroid Association does not routinely recommend combination therapy but acknowledges it may benefit select patients with persistent symptoms despite normal TSH on levothyroxine alone.

Nutritional Interventions:

Hypothyroid patients may benefit from specific dietary approaches:

  • Caloric deficit: Modest reduction of 500-750 calories daily, targeting 1-2 pounds weekly weight loss

  • Protein optimization: 1.2-1.6 g/kg body weight to preserve lean mass during weight loss (adjust for patients with chronic kidney disease under medical supervision)

  • Anti-inflammatory diet: Mediterranean-style eating patterns may benefit patients with autoimmune thyroiditis

  • Micronutrient attention: Adequate iodine intake (RDA 150 mcg/day; upper limit 1,100 mcg/day); avoid excessive iodine supplements and seaweed products

Concerns about goitrogenic foods (raw cruciferous vegetables) are generally not clinically significant in iodine-replete settings with normal thyroid function or well-controlled hypothyroidism.

Physical Activity:

Exercise provides metabolic benefits beyond caloric expenditure. Recommendations include:

  • 150-300 minutes weekly moderate-intensity aerobic activity

  • Resistance training 2-3 times weekly to maintain muscle mass

  • Non-exercise activity thermogenesis (NEAT) optimization through increased daily movement

Pharmacological Alternatives:

Beyond GLP-1 receptor agonists, FDA-approved weight loss medications include:

  • Phentermine-topiramate (Qsymia): Appetite suppressant combination

  • Naltrexone-bupropion (Contrave): Affects reward pathways and appetite

  • Orlistat (Xenical, Alli): Lipase inhibitor reducing fat absorption

These alternatives have different mechanisms, adverse effect profiles, and efficacy (typically 5-10% weight loss), allowing individualized selection.

Bariatric Surgery:

Metabolic and bariatric surgery should be considered for patients with BMI ≥40 kg/m² or ≥35 kg/m² with obesity-related comorbidities. Recent guidelines suggest considering surgery at lower BMI thresholds (≥30 kg/m²) for patients with type 2 diabetes.

Behavioral and Psychological Support:

Cognitive-behavioral therapy, mindful eating practices, and support groups enhance long-term success. Addressing emotional eating, stress management, and sleep optimization (hypothyroid patients often experience sleep disturbances) provides comprehensive care. Referral to registered dietitians and behavioral health specialists should be considered for patients with complex needs or previous weight loss failures.

Frequently Asked Questions

Do weight loss injections affect thyroid hormone levels?

GLP-1 receptor agonists do not directly affect thyroid hormone production or metabolism. However, significant weight loss may reduce thyroid hormone requirements, potentially necessitating levothyroxine dose adjustments as patients lose weight.

Should I take my thyroid medication at a different time when using weight loss injections?

Continue taking levothyroxine on an empty stomach 30-60 minutes before breakfast as recommended. While GLP-1 medications delay gastric emptying, maintaining optimal levothyroxine timing helps ensure consistent absorption.

How often should thyroid function be monitored when taking weight loss injections?

Thyroid function tests (TSH, free T4) should be checked at baseline, 6-8 weeks after achieving maintenance dose of the weight loss medication, and every 3-6 months during active weight loss to ensure appropriate thyroid hormone replacement.
